Emergency Exit not Marked

Recalled: September 11, 2019 ~18 units affected 19V650

Description

Keystone RV Company (Keystone) is recalling certain 2020 Cougar 30RKD trailers. The 60"x29" emergency exit windows over the dinette table in the cabin are missing a red handle and "EXIT" label.

Injuries / Consequence

If an emergency event occurs, trailer occupants may not be aware of the emergency exit function of the window, increasing the risk of an injury.

Remedy

Keystone will notify owners, and dealers will replace the existing black exit handles with red handles and add an "EXIT" label, free of charge. The recall began October 9, 2019. Owners may contact Keystone customer service at 1-866-425-4369. Keystone's number for this recall is 19-360.
